项目 内容
课程班级博客 21级信计班
作业要求链接 作业要求
课程学习目标 熟练完成作业,提高编程能力
这个作业对我的帮助 增加了对编程能力的理解

(一)
6、请编程序将“China”译成密码,密码规律是:用原来的字母后面第4个字母代替原来的字母。例如,字母“A"后面第4个字母是“E”,用“E”代替“A”。因此,“China”应译为“GImre”。 请编一程序,用赋初值的方法使c1,c2.c3.c4.c5这5个变量的值分别为C','h','i','n','a' ,经过运算,使c1,c2,c3,c4,c5分别变为'G','T','m','r',e'。 分别用putchar函数和printf函数输出这5个字符。
代码如下:

点击查看代码
int main()
{ char a='C',b='h',c='i',d='n',e='a';
a=a+4;
b=b+4;
c=c+4;
d=d+4;
e=e+4;
printf("加密密码为:\n");
putchar(a);
putchar(b);
putchar(c);
putchar(d);
putchar(e);
return 0;
}

7、设圆半径r=1.5,圆柱高h=3,求圆周长、圆面积、圆球表面积、圆球体积、圆柱体积。用scanf输人数据,输出计算结果,输出时要求有文字说明,取小数点后2位数字2编程序。
代码如下:

点击查看代码
#define pi 3.14
int main()
{
float r,h,c,s,b,v,v1;
printf("请输入圆的半径和圆柱高!");
scanf("%f,%f",&r,&h);
c=2*pi*r;
s=pi*r*r;
b=4*pi*r*r;
v=4/3*pi*r*r*r;
v1=pi*r*h;
printf("圆的周长%2.2f,圆的面积%2.2f,圆球的表面积%2.2f,圆球体积%2.2f,圆柱体积%2.2f",c,s,b,v,v1);
return 0;

}

(二)
心得体会:
通过本次学习,学习了简单的c语言顺序结构例题介绍,顺序结构是最简单的一种程序结构,其它的结构可以包含顺序结构也可以作为顺序结构的组成部分,可见顺序结构无处不在,他是构成其他程序结构的基础。在顺序结构程序中,各语句是按自上而下的顺序执行的,执行完上一个语句就自动执行下一个语句,是无条件的,不必作任何判断。还学会了数学函数库、abs函数、fabs函数、sqrt函数、sin函数等等,充分掌握在编写博客和代码时对数学计算的熟练运用。

posted on 2022-03-25 16:30  不做梵高呀!  阅读(104)  评论(0)    收藏  举报